Fluorine in PDB 3d71: Crystal Structure of E253Q Bmrr Bound to 22 Base Pair Promoter SiteProtein crystallography data
The structure of Crystal Structure of E253Q Bmrr Bound to 22 Base Pair Promoter Site, PDB code: 3d71
was solved by
K.J.Newberry,
J.L.Huffman,
R.G.Brennan,
with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Reference:
K.J.Newberry,
J.L.Huffman,
M.C.Miller,
N.Vazquez-Laslop,
A.A.Neyfakh,
R.G.Brennan.
Structures of Bmrr-Drug Complexes Reveal A Rigid Multidrug Binding Pocket and Transcription Activation Through Tyrosine Expulsion J.Biol.Chem. V. 283 26795 2008.
